The U.S. Open in New York 2026 Guide

The 2026 U.S. Open returns to New York for another summer of world-class tennis, bringing the sport’s biggest stars to Queens for the final major tournament of the season. The tournament runs from August 23 through September 13, 2026.
Tournament Schedule
The U.S. Open begins with qualifying matches before moving into mixed doubles, quad wheelchair matches, and men’s and women’s singles competition.
The main draw runs from August 30 through the end of the tournament. Qualifying matches are scheduled for August 24–27 as part of Fan Week, which takes place immediately before the main draw.
Fan Week is free to attend, although some experiences require paid tickets. Activities include player practices, on-court activities and other activations throughout the grounds, with the US Open Qualifying Tournament serving as the centerpiece.
Where to Watch the U.S. Open
The U.S. Open takes place at the USTA Billie Jean King National Tennis Center in Flushing Meadows-Corona Park in Queens.
For fans unable to attend in person, ESPN and ESPN+ typically provide coverage of the tournament.
Tickets and Food
Tickets for the 2026 U.S. Open are now on sale. The tournament grounds also feature a range of bars and cafes, while nearby Flushing offers a wide selection of restaurants.
Flushing Meadows-Corona Park, home to the tennis center, is also one of New York’s major attractions and among the popular destinations to visit in Queens.
